Output d85a39f26f7f31ca2edd4f176bc90fa6e8c5df4e384682d3e51d738a65aa17d3:0

value
40855432
script pubkey
OP_0 OP_PUSHBYTES_20 db9650bb260f8d02f17fc3328d6d0990edbe2587
address
bc1qmwt9pwexp7xs9utlcveg6mgfjrkmufv8tcpyvh
transaction
d85a39f26f7f31ca2edd4f176bc90fa6e8c5df4e384682d3e51d738a65aa17d3
confirmations
76404
spent
true